Synopses & Reviews

Publisher Comments:

David Gianatasio is not afraid to use all caps. At first we were a little suspicious of a writer who likes to use the Web-parlance for screaming at someone in much of his writing - and then it began to sink in:

David is crazy.

And the stories in this collection are fine proof of the fact. A story that seems like a straight suspenseful, X-Filesesque adventure becomes something twisted and - ultimately - depraved and hilarious. Something itches into your brain and makes the crazy shared.

David likes to take the common and mundane and warp it just a little, just a tweak to make you believe you know where he's headed... before yanking the tablecloth out altogether to watch the dishes go flying.

Swift Kicks is full of the little punches that make life fun, the brushes with mania that shove us through our office mazes and coffee-soaked days. This is the kind of book you want to leave in the company breakroom once you're done with it, because crazy this good deserves to be shared, whether they know it or not.

Including an introduction by Claire Zulkey, So New Media is proud to present David Gianatasio's first collection.

About the Author

David's work has appeared all over the Web, including some of these fine sites: Ad Week's Ad Freak, Alice Blue Review, The 2nd Hand, Flymf, Ad Freak again!, McSweeney's Internet Tendency, Pindeldyboz, and Eyeshot.
